(0 votes) Now that you've provided the plugin operation log, it's clear why your images are no longer generating.
Your log shows that your settings are configured to use DALL-E 3. However, OpenAI officially stopped supporting and removed the DALL-E model lineup (including both DALL-E 2 and DALL-E 3) on May 12, 2026. You can find more information about the end of Dall-E on the OpenAI developer community forum:
Login to see this link
We kept DALL-E 3 available in all of our autoblogging plugins until the last moment to ensure that anyone who was still using it could keep using it. But now that the API is no longer supported by OpenAI, we will, of course, remove this model from the list of supported options in the upcoming plugin updates.
To solve the problem, just open your settings and change your image generation method.

You have the Operation log in the plugin where you can see the exact causes of all errors. In your case, you'll see messages like "Error: Unknown parameter: 'response_format'" or "Error: The model 'dall-e-3' does not exist" right after the "Generate dall-e-3 image for..." line. As a webmaster, you have to monitor the status of third-party tools and AI models that you choose to use.
Yes, all supported models work in conjunction with the plugin code via API. However, these models are not free. You need to purchase an API key for the specific service you plan to use.
The plugin generates section titles in a standard magazine style, such as "Early life in Brooklyn". There is no need to fix this manually. Your WordPress theme, not the plugin, controls text rendering on the screen. To force them to look exactly how you want, go to your WordPress dashboard, click on Appearance, then click on Customize, and finally click on Additional CSS. Add this line to force uppercase:
Login to see the code
As for the unfinished sentences. This is a strict API limit issue. To prevent this, increase the Max tokens limit in your campaign settings to give the AI enough space to properly finish the text with a period.
The API keys are configured on the Settings page of the plugin. There are fields named CometAPI API key and GoAPI API key. The descriptions directly below them clearly state: "Get your CometAPI API key to use CometAPI for image generation with Midjourney and Flux" and "Get your GoAPI API key to use GoAPI for image generation with Midjourney and Flux", depending on which API provider you are using.

1. The plugin was originally designed to integrate CometAPI and GoAPI specifically to support Midjourney. Since both services included Flux under the same API system, we enabled Flux through them to avoid adding redundant code. The plugin does not connect to Black Forest Labs directly. However, a plugin update adding OpenRouter support will be released in a couple of days. This update will enable you to use various Flux models and many other excellent alternatives through your OpenRouter account.
2. Different plugins handle this differently. This plugin saves clean, standard editorial text to your database. This gives you maximum flexibility because your theme can easily change the visual appearance to uppercase or capitalized text via CSS without altering the text itself.
However, you can always change the heading style explicitly. For example:

3. This is entirely a matter of prompting, not a limitation of the plugin itself. Different AI models generate different amounts of text. Even the GPT-4o mini can be verbose if left unrestricted. To tame the output and make it shorter, you must explicitly request the desired length in your prompt. Add a strict instruction to your system prompt or section template, such as: "Keep each section short with a maximum of two paragraphs and get straight to the point". The AI will follow your instructions, write less, and finish its sentences within your token limit.
